Output 050285688ae75f786aa113b91333f54a9918cdccb44132cc56ae2b5d0e5c783a:6
- value
- 7815136
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d86269397f9e631536605442b25e29e08747b2959491ed1bb524a353f9d38e88
- address
- tb1pmp3xjwtlne332dnq23ptyh3fuzr50v54jjg76xa4yj3487wn36yqtvgz5g
- transaction
- 050285688ae75f786aa113b91333f54a9918cdccb44132cc56ae2b5d0e5c783a
- confirmations
- 26033
- spent
- true